Overview

The MAD 8112 IPE Silver drone motor is positioned for industrial drones and professional mapping applications. It is built for 12S voltage systems, emphasizing longevity and a lightweight structure, and is stated as 5% lighter than typical 81-series motors. The silver housing is designed to improve heat dissipation in high-temperature environments.

Key Features

  • Built-in cooling fan for improved airflow and thermal performance
  • 36N40P multi-slot multipole design for torque and responsiveness
  • High-grade bearings for smooth, stable operation over extended use
  • Silver housing for heat dissipation in high-temperature environments

Specifications

Motor Model MAD 8112 IPE V1.0 silver
KV (RPM/V) 100 KV
Nominal Voltage 12S lipo battery
Number of pole pairs 20
Slot/Pole 36N40P
Stator Anticorrosive
Varnished wire Degree 180°C
Magnet Degree 150°C
Degree of Protection IP35
Cable Length 150 mm 16# Awg(Black) silicone
Centrifugal Heat Dissipation YES
Rotor Balance ≤10 mg
Motor Balance ≤20 mg
Propeller Mounting Holes D:20 M3×4, D:23 M4×4
Motor Mounting Holes D:40 M4×4
Shaft Diameter IN: 15 mm
Bearing 6902ZZ*2
Disruptive test 500 V
Motor Size D:88.6 × 32.5 mm
Optimized Weight 382 g
Recommended hover thrust 4.0~6.0 kgf
Maximum thrust 11.1 kgf
Efficiency >80%
No Load Current 1.1A/30V
Internal resistance 91 mΩ
Maximum Current 41 A
Maximum Power 1937 W
Maximum Torque 3.9 N·m
Recommended ESC MAD AMPX 40A (5-14S) HV
Recommended Propellers 28x8.2, 29x8.7, 30x10.0
UAV take-off weight 12S 28" / 4kg-Quadcopter 21kg-Hexacopter 28kg-Octocopter
Single rotor take-off weight 4kg ~ 6kg
Product Boxed Weight 682 g (150 x 150 x 65 mm)

Performance Data (12S / 48V reference)

Measured with an input voltage of 48 V, at 25°C and sea level. Rotational speed was adjusted by throttle.

FLUXER PRO 28x8.4 MATT + AMPX 40A (5-14S) HV (12S, MAX 70°C)

Throttle (%) Voltage (V) Current (A) Input Power (W) Output Power (W) Torque (N·m) RPM Thrust (g) Efficiency (%) Efficiency (gf/W)
30 48.19 1.91 91.5 64.6 0.408 1497 1240 69.99 13.5
35 48.18 2.68 128.9 95.0 0.531 1710 1615 73.87 12.7
40 48.17 3.63 174.2 131.9 0.658 1915 2045 75.67 11.7
45 48.16 4.77 229.4 179.3 0.807 2124 2524 78.13 11.0
50 48.15 6.38 306.6 246.0 0.995 2350 3118 80.19 10.2
55 48.12 8.21 394.3 320.1 1.178 2595 3642 81.14 9.2
60 48.06 10.39 498.9 409.1 1.394 2802 4356 81.96 8.7
65 48.05 12.57 603.7 498.5 1.591 2992 4985 82.53 8.3
70 48 15.24 730.9 601.5 1.813 3169 5647 82.23 7.7
75 47.97 17.56 841.9 704.2 2.008 3349 6285 83.6 7.5
80 47.88 20.37 974.7 832.1 2.260 3516 7109 85.34 7.3
85 47.87 23.88 1142.5 962.4 2.483 3701 7852 84.19 6.9
90 47.86 29.05 1390.1 1105.4 2.734 3862 8606 79.49 6.2
95 47.76 35.36 1688.3 1310.9 3.079 4056 9616 77.61 5.7
100 47.71 33.46 1595.8 1302.5 3.064 4059 9543 81.62 6.0

FLUXER PRO 29x8.7 MATT + AMPX 40A (5-14S) HV (12S, MAX 83°C)

Throttle (%) Voltage (V) Current (A) Input Power (W) Output Power (W) Torque (N·m) RPM Thrust (g) Efficiency (%) Efficiency (gf/W)
30 48.2 1.99 95.6 72.3 0.463 1493 1425 75.65 14.8
35 48.2 2.82 135.2 107.5 0.603 1703 1888 79.44 13.8
40 48.19 3.85 185.5 149.9 0.752 1906 2235 80.76 12.3
45 48.18 5.18 249.1 205.0 0.931 2103 2884 82.26 11.6
50 48.17 6.94 333.7 274.9 1.125 2334 3494 82.34 10.5
55 48.11 9.07 435.8 361.5 1.352 2554 4270 82.92 9.7
60 48.07 11.31 543.2 452.6 1.568 2757 4874 83.27 9.0
65 48.06 13.82 663.6 550.4 1.789 2939 5572 82.89 8.4
70 48.05 17.04 818.5 656.9 2.016 3113 6234 80.2 7.6
75 47.95 20.14 965.3 770.6 2.246 3278 6973 79.79 7.2
80 47.87 22.11 1057.6 899.5 2.486 3441 7716 84.65 7.3
85 47.81 25.84 1234.8 1046.0 2.767 3610 8516 84.57 6.9
90 47.79 30.37 1450.8 1183.3 3.005 3760 9276 81.52 6.4
95 47.69 35.81 1707.3 1378.4 3.323 3961 10199 80.69 6.0
100 47.67 35.91 1711.1 1378.2 3.337 3944 10292 80.51 6.0

FLUXER PRO 30x10.0in MATT + AMPX 40A (5-14S) HV (12S, MAX 92°C)

Throttle (%) Voltage (V) Current (A) Input Power (W) Output Power (W) Torque (N·m) RPM Thrust (g) Efficiency (%) Efficiency (gf/W)
30 48.2 2.37 113.4 89.8 0.587 1462 1684 79.15 14.8
35 48.19 3.35 160.8 130.0 0.744 1669 2174 80.76 13.5
40 48.18 4.64 223.0 180.3 0.923 1865 2714 80.79 12.1
45 48.16 6.22 298.9 244.2 1.139 2049 3324 81.65 11.1
50 48.15 8.23 395.6 324.5 1.369 2235 3996 81.97 10.1
55 48.09 10.7 513.9 422.6 1.635 2468 4835 82.17 9.4
60 48.07 13.68 656.9 531.5 1.915 2650 5634 80.87 8.6
65 48.03 15.26 780.3 641.4 2.168 2825 6379 82.17 8.2
70 47.96 19.89 953.4 754.2 2.409 2990 7071 79.08 7.4
75 47.95 23.94 1147.4 878.6 2.677 3134 7851 76.54 6.8
80 47.84 26.3 1258.0 1015.0 2.952 3284 8631 80.85 6.9
85 47.77 30.96 1478.2 1154.5 3.218 3427 9432 78.05 6.4
90 47.66 35.47 1690.0 1314.1 3.509 3576 10163 77.71 6.0
95 47.59 42.68 2030.3 1516.2 3.881 3731 11258 74.53 5.5
100 47.57 40.73 1937.0 1498.6 3.854 3714 11714 77.34 5.7

The above data are the theoretical values when the input voltage is 48 V, for reference only. With an additional cooling device: current over 41 A is a non-working zone; 16–41 A is a short-term working zone (about 10–30 s); and below 16 A is a sustainable working zone. Control motor running time according to ambient temperature and heat dissipation conditions.
